We are seeking to commission an experienced Technical Project Manager (TPM) for a period of around two years to play a key role in the first phase of one of the most important heritage rescue projects in the UK today.

A category-A listed building designed by William Adam, and a masterpiece of the Scottish Enlightenment, Mavisbank House near Edinburgh has been a cause celebre in the heritage industry since a catastrophic fire in the late 1970s. Complex ownership and access arrangements, and the building’s poor condition, have hindered numerous previous attempts to save it.

Following a breakthrough grant from the National Heritage Memorial Fund (NHMF) in 2024, and working with Midlothian Council, Historic Environment Scotland and the Mavisbank Trust, the Landmark Trust is now in a position to set about rescuing this remarkable building.
